About the Book:
Raina Bretton is a rag woman in London's east end when a handsome stranger appears in a dank alley and offers her a glittering smile and a chance for adventure. Rothburne Abbey has a unique position for her, one that will take her away from her hardscrabble life and give her a chance to be a lady. Things she could only dream of might be coming true. But some dreams turn out to be nightmares.

Though Raina has traded squalor for silk and satin, something about the abbey is deeply unsettling. As she wrestles with her true identity, the ruin, decay, and secrets she finds at the heart of the old mansion tear at her confidence and threaten to reveal her for who she really is. Only one man stands between her and the danger that lurks within--and only if he decides to keep her biggest secret hidden.

My Thoughts:
Let me start by saying that this book was not for me. I'm in a minority here if the reviews on Amazon are any indication. 

I was intrigued by the back cover and the actual book cover. The way the book is described had me expecting a sort-of My Fair Lady type story. And it sort of is. 

Yet, I couldn't get into this book. I tried. I really did try. Perhaps this author's style isn't for me. I didn't connect to the characters. I was bored while reading it. In fact, I kept looking for reasons NOT to read the book. 

Obviously, I'm in a minority. Others LOVE the book. Others whose opinions I respect have raved about this book. And to be perfectly honest, I kept wondering "What are they seeing that I'm missing?" Followed by "when will it get better?" 

I know that not every book I pick up is going to be one that I love. Just like I know that not every author is for every reader. But I still don't like giving a negative review because I know how hard authors work on their book babies. 

This one, it's not for me. I plan on donating my copy to my local library though, so that others CAN enjoy the book.
